Where P2P Lending Is in Europe Now and What to Expect in 2019

Posted on

Peer-to-peer (P2P) lending is roughly a decade old, and it not only disrupted the financial services sector after the global financial crises, but has paved the way forward when it comes to investing and borrowing money.

In Europe, the United Kingdom (UK) is still the largest P2P player and the birthplace thereof. The rest of Europe is fast catching up and the number of platforms has sharply increased with returns far exceeding that of stock markets and fixed-term deposits. History of Peer-to-Peer (P2P) Lending in Europe

Posted on

Peer-to-Peer (P2P) lending is essentially the result of the financial crisis of 2008 where banks were folding due to the subprime mortgage defaults and capital was drying up. The world’s economies literally came to a standstill and it was difficult to do business.

Will 2019 be the Year of Fintech Acquisitions?

Posted on

Looking at the trend of the last two years when financial institutions have started investing big money in fintech firms all around the globe, hence significantly increasing the number of mergers and acquisitions (M&As), it really seems this could be the boom year. Seeing banks and large financial institutions investing in and acquiring financial technology companies appears quite natural when in the recent past they have not been able to keep pace with fintech newcomers and with the needs of their own customers, despite of their efforts to modernize their services and develop digital innovations internally.
